Tunnel of Oppression, November 7th – November 9th, Campus Center 4th Floor
The Tunnel of Oppression is an interactive production created by the Social Justice Scholars, Resident Assistants, and
other dedicated staff and students. The Tunnel aims to highlight contemporary social justice issues and to introduce
participants to the concepts of oppression, micro-aggressions, and the “isms” faced by numerous communities in
today’s society. Participants are guided through a series of scenes that aim to educate and challenge them to think
critically about issues of oppression. At the end of the tour, participants are provided with the opportunity to discuss
their experiences with each other through a guided facilitation led by a faculty or staff member.

JagNation Ambassador Training (Bystander Intervention), Tuesday, November 8 th, 3:30pm – 5:00pm, Campus Center
270
Learn to embody the Culture of Care philosophy with this intimate small group training session. Formally acquire the
skills and recognition that bring JagNation to life. Ambassador Training is a 90-minute interactive seminar built around
bystander intervention and harm reduction. Content includes icebreakers, alcohol and sexual assault prevention,
scenario practice, and discussion on social barriers to intervention. Think outside yourself and connect with others on a
